About Gosnells 6110

The size of Gosnells is approximately 14.8 square kilometres. There are 54 parks, covering nearly 15.7% of the total area. The population of Gosnells in 2016 was 20293 people. By 2021 the population was 21149 showing a population growth of 4.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Gosnells is 30-39 years. Households in Gosnells are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Gosnells work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 64.30% of the homes in Gosnells were owner-occupied compared with 66.70% in 2016.
